Australian rules footballer


Tammy Hynes (11 August 1897 – 9 September 1969) was an Australian rules footballer who played with South Melbourne in the Victorian Football League (VFL).

Hynes was a member of South Melbourne's 1918 premiership team, in his debut season. A centreman, Hynes retired in 1924 after 57 league games. His grandson Tom played for South Melbourne during the 1960s.
